Venus Williams is returning to the US Open 2026 .

Event organizers announced that the four-time Olympic gold medalist and seven-time major singles champion had joined the mixed doubles field, along with partner Alexander Bublik , yesterday (3 August).

The prize for winning? A cool USD$1 million for the victorious duo. The substantially increased prize money has been a major draw to reel in some of the sport’s top players.

After the success of last year’s Fan Week - the lead-up preceding the Grand Slam - mixed doubles will once again serve as the headliner.

Last year, 78,000 spectators filled Arthur Ashe Stadium in New York City over the two days the semi-finals and finals were played.

The six pairs with the best combined singles rankings receive automatic entry for the main draw.

After that, the United States Tennis Association gives out wild cards to eight teams. The final two teams will come out of the new qualifying tournament on 24 August.

Williams will tune up for her mixed doubles match by playing with her sister, and fellow Olympic gold medalist, Serena Williams in women’s doubles at the 2026 Cincinnati Open.
